Eco-design in Buildings is Stalled by Knowledge and Tool Gaps

The widespread adoption of eco-design principles in the building sector is significantly impeded by a lack of accessible knowledge and appropriate design tools among practitioners.

Urban Science · 2021

01

Key Findings

  • 01Lack of suitable legislation is a significant barrier.
  • 02Building designers often lack the necessary knowledge regarding eco-design principles.
  • 03A shortage of appropriate tools hinders the practical application of eco-design.
  • 04Specific tools and nine design strategies exist to guide environmental considerations.

Method & Evidence

AimWhat are the primary barriers hindering the implementation of eco-design in the building sector, and what tools and strategies can support building designers in incorporating environmental considerations?
MethodSystematic Literature Review
ProcedureA comprehensive review of existing literature was conducted to identify barriers to eco-design in buildings and to uncover available tools and strategies for environmental consideration in the design process.
ContextBuilding Design and Construction
